<pre>This is still unresolved in Safari, including the nightly. All other major browsers appear to have fixed this which can be verified by loading up <a href="http://people.mozilla.org/~dholbert/tests/flexbox/compat_tests/percent-height-grandchild-1.html">http://people.mozilla.org/~dholbert/tests/flexbox/compat_tests/percent-height-grandchild-1.html</a>. Safari is the only browser that still shows red and is not conforming to spec <a href="https://drafts.csswg.org/css-flexbox/#algo-stretch">https://drafts.csswg.org/css-flexbox/#algo-stretch</a> "If the flex item has align-self: stretch, redo layout for its contents, treating this used size as its definite cross size so that percentage-sized children can be resolved." Here's the chromium patch that resolved it <a href="https://chromium.googlesource.com/chromium/src/+/0702247984d85e123f0ad2074e69743c710050ad">https://chromium.googlesource.com/chromium/src/+/0702247984d85e123f0ad2074e69743c710050ad</a></pre>
